abc.aspectj.types
Class AJFlags

java.lang.Object
  extended by Flags
      extended by abc.aspectj.types.AJFlags

public class AJFlags
extends Flags

Author:
Oege de Moor

Field Summary
static Flags ASPECTCLASS
           
static Flags INTERFACEORIGIN
           
static Flags INTERTYPE
           
static Flags PRIVILEGEDASPECT
           
 
Constructor Summary
AJFlags()
           
 
Method Summary
static Flags aspectclass(Flags f)
           
static Flags clearAspectclass(Flags f)
           
static Flags clearInterfaceorigin(Flags f)
           
static Flags clearIntertype(Flags f)
           
static Flags clearPrivilegedaspect(Flags f)
           
static Flags interfaceorigin(Flags f)
           
static Flags intertype(Flags f)
           
static boolean isAspectclass(Flags f)
           
static boolean isInterfaceorigin(Flags f)
           
static boolean isIntertype(Flags f)
           
static boolean isPrivilegedaspect(Flags f)
           
static Flags privilegedaspect(Flags f)
           
 
Methods inherited from class java.lang.Object
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
 

Field Detail

PRIVILEGEDASPECT

public static final Flags PRIVILEGEDASPECT

ASPECTCLASS

public static final Flags ASPECTCLASS

INTERTYPE

public static final Flags INTERTYPE

INTERFACEORIGIN

public static final Flags INTERFACEORIGIN
Constructor Detail

AJFlags

public AJFlags()
Method Detail

aspectclass

public static Flags aspectclass(Flags f)

clearAspectclass

public static Flags clearAspectclass(Flags f)

isAspectclass

public static boolean isAspectclass(Flags f)

privilegedaspect

public static Flags privilegedaspect(Flags f)

clearPrivilegedaspect

public static Flags clearPrivilegedaspect(Flags f)

isPrivilegedaspect

public static boolean isPrivilegedaspect(Flags f)

intertype

public static Flags intertype(Flags f)

clearIntertype

public static Flags clearIntertype(Flags f)

isIntertype

public static boolean isIntertype(Flags f)

interfaceorigin

public static Flags interfaceorigin(Flags f)

clearInterfaceorigin

public static Flags clearInterfaceorigin(Flags f)

isInterfaceorigin

public static boolean isInterfaceorigin(Flags f)